+# 对单个模型操作
+def model_to_dict(model, fields=None, exchange_fields=None):
+ """
+ 将Flask SQLAlchemy的模型对象转换为字典类型
+ :param: model : 模型对象
+ :param: fields : 需要获取的字段列表,默认为 None,获取全部字段
+ :param: exchange_fields : 需要替换名字的字段,{'数据库字段':'前端展示字段'},有些数据库字段名在展示时需要修改成前端需要的名字
+ :return: 返回字典类型
+ """
+ # 传递空值时
+ if not model:
+ return {}
+ if fields is None:
+ # 获取所有列名
+ columns = [column.name for column in model.__table__.columns]
+ # 排除掉relationships 设置的反向查询字段
+ relations = getattr(model.__class__, '__mapper__').relationships
+ exclude_cols = [rel.key for rel in relations]
+ # print(exclude_cols,'要剔除的反向查询字段')
+ # 拿到所有列名-排除的列名
+ cols = set(columns) - set(exclude_cols)
+ fields = list(cols)
+
+ obj_dict = {}
+ for field in fields:
+ if field not in model.__dict__:
+ continue
+
+ value = model.__dict__[field]
+ # 1、对时间字段进行操作
+ if isinstance(value, datetime.datetime):
+ # 字段类型是datetime的,格式化
+ value = value.strftime('%Y-%m-%d %H:%M:%S')
+ if isinstance(value, datetime.date):
+ # 字段类型是date的,格式化
+ value = value.strftime('%Y-%m-%d')
+ # 2、将所有可以进行反序列化的进行反序列化(将json字符串转成python结构数据类型)
+ if isinstance(value, str):
+ try:
+ value = json.loads(value)
+ except Exception as _:
+ pass
+ #3、替换展示的字段
+ if type(exchange_fields) == dict:
+ for db_field, show_field in exchange_fields.items():
+ #db_field 是数据库字段,show_field是展示字段名
+ if field == db_field:
+ field = show_field
+
+ obj_dict[field] = value
+
+ return obj_dict
